# Maintainer: moostik <mooostik_at_gmail.com>
# Contributor: Blaž Tomažič <blaz.tomazic@gmail.com>
pkgname=python-orange
pkgver=2.5a2
pkgrel=1
pkgdesc="Open source data visualization and analysis for novice and experts. Data mining through visual programming or Python scripting."
arch=('i686' 'x86_64')
url="http://www.ailab.si/orange"
license=('GPL')
depends=('python2' 'python2-numpy' 'python-numarray' 'python-numeric' 'python2-matplotlib')
optdepends=('pyqwt: GUI support' 'python-networkx: Network module')
conflicts=('python-orange-hg' 'python-orange-svn')
source=("http://pypi.python.org/packages/source/O/Orange/Orange-${pkgver}.tar.gz")
md5sums=('055c68245c7bb3eb3c096f23917d71b8')
build() {
cd "${srcdir}/Orange-$pkgver"
python2 setup.py build || return 1
}
package() {
cd "${srcdir}/Orange-$pkgver"
python2 setup.py install --root="${pkgdir}" || return 1
find ${pkgdir} -name '*.py' | while read FILE; do
sed -i -e "s|#![ ]*/usr/bin/python$|#!/usr/bin/python2|" \
-e "s|#![ ]*/usr/bin/env python$|#!/usr/bin/env python2|" \
-e "s|#![ ]*/bin/env python$|#!/usr/bin/env python2|" \
"$FILE"
done
}
# vim:set ts=2 sw=2 et: